Report on the Administration of the Constitutional Centre of Western Australia

Public Accounts Committee (1986 - 2001)· 25 November 1999general_report

The Public Accounts Committee investigated the Constitutional Centre of WA's administration, finding significant budget overruns due to poor financial management and inadequate oversight. Procedures for supply, contracts, and human resources were not followed, and the Advisory Board lacked sufficient financial information. Corrective measures have since been implemented.
